A foam trigger sprayer is a dispensing closure designed to transform liquid formulas into a thick foam spray. Unlike traditional trigger sprayers that release liquid droplets, foam sprayers combine the product with air through an internal foaming mechanism, creating a stable and easy-to-apply foam.
This technology makes foam trigger sprayers an ideal choice for products that require wider coverage and controlled application.

1. Improved Product Coverage
Foam spreads more evenly across surfaces compared with traditional liquid sprays. This allows users to cover larger areas with less product.
For example, in automotive detailing applications, foam helps distribute cleaning solutions evenly on dashboards, seats, wheels, and other vehicle surfaces.
2. Reduced Product Waste
Because foam remains on the surface longer, users can control the amount applied more effectively. This helps reduce excessive spraying and improves overall product efficiency.
3. Better User Experience
A smooth foam texture provides a more convenient and premium application experience. For brands competing in the cleaning and automotive care markets, packaging performance can directly influence customer satisfaction.
4. Suitable for Various Formulations
High-quality plastic trigger sprayers are designed to work with different liquid formulations, including detergents, cleaners, and automotive chemicals.
However, when sourcing a sprayer, it is important to confirm chemical compatibility between the formula and the sprayer materials.

3. Test Spray Performance
A premium foam trigger sprayer should provide stable and reliable spraying performance.
Important testing factors include:
Foam Consistency
The sprayer should produce uniform foam instead of unstable liquid output.
Trigger Operation
The trigger should feel comfortable and operate smoothly after repeated use.
Leak Prevention
A reliable sealing structure helps prevent leakage during storage and transportation.
Spray Output
The output volume should match the requirements of the product formula.
Before purchasing in bulk, companies should request samples and perform application tests with their own formulas.

What is a foam trigger sprayer?
A foam trigger sprayer is a dispensing solution that mixes liquid and air to create foam output. It is commonly used for cleaning products, automotive care solutions, and other applications requiring controlled foam spraying.
What products use foam trigger sprayers?
Foam trigger sprayers are widely used for household cleaners, car care products, detergents, disinfectants, and maintenance solutions.
How do I choose a trigger sprayer wholesale supplier?
When selecting a supplier, consider manufacturing experience, material quality, spray performance, customization options, production capacity, and quality control systems.
Can foam trigger sprayers be customized?
Yes. Many manufacturers provide customization services, including color matching, logo printing, packaging design, and OEM solutions.
Are foam trigger sprayers suitable for automotive cleaning products?
Yes. Foam trigger sprayers are commonly used for automotive detailing products because they provide even coverage, controlled application, and improved cleaning efficiency.
